The Enrolled Nurse is responsible for direct and/or indirect nursing care of a patient or group of patients and will function under the direct and/or indirect supervision of the Registered Nurse.

The incumbent is also responsible for and is held accountable for his/her own acts and omissions. Nursing activities form part of a nursing regime that is planned and initiated by the Registered Nurse. The Enrolled Nurse is responsible for the assessment, care and needs of patients; and for the development, implementation and evaluation of appropriate programmes of care, ensuring the delivery of high quality care to patients.

Key work output and accountabilities

Administration Management

  • Ensure that all documentation is maintained timeously and accurately, reflecting patient care
  • Ensure all stock is charged appropriately
  • Assist with file compilation

Governance, quality and risk management

  • Maintain a therapeutic, clean and safe environment that is free from medico-legal hazards
  • Adhere to Netcare medical waste management principles and all other waste management principles
  • Maintain a safe working environment in accordance with the Machinery and Occupational Safety Act
  • Report potential/actual risks identified
  • Ensure all stock is well controlled and managed
  • Responsible for ensuring correct use, cleaning and storage of equipment
  • Report equipment needing repair or replacement to the Sister-In-Charge
  • Maintain professional conduct and standards at all times in accordance with hospital policies and procedures
  • Maintain patient confidentiality at all times

 

Patient care

  • Practice patient care according to the Scope of Practice and assume total responsibility for these activities
  • Contribute to the holistic care of patients
  • Participate in clinic’s quality improvement programme
  • Effective communication with patients regarding their care
  • Promotion of patient overall health and wellbeing
  • Practice the principles of infection prevention and all standard precautions
  • Promote and maintain good public relations with patients, relatives and visitors
  • Execute all procedures according to given standards as per the scope of practice
  • Report all complaints from patients and doctors to the Theatre Unit Manager
  • Report all incidents and near misses to the Theatre Unit Manager
  • Carry out all departmental duties as assigned by the Registered Nurse / Theatre Unit Manager
  • Ensure that patient valuables are locked away

Teamwork

  • Actively participate as a member of a team to achieve goals

Skills profile

Education

  • Grade 12 or equivalent NQF 4 certificate
  • Registration with the South African Nursing Council as an Enrolled Nurse or equivalent NQF level 4 qualification
  • Compliance with the SANC code for Enrolled Nursing and all applicable Health Care Legislation

Work experience

  • Previous experience in hospital/clinic environment would be desirable
  • Knowledge of Medical Schemes advantageous
  • Computer literacy

Knowledge

  • Thorough knowledge of general/primary care nursing theory and practice
  • Extensive knowledge of modern nursing care principles and practices in the highly specialised field of the intensive care nursing
